Henry Humphries was a merchant located at the corner of South Elm and West Market streets.

He also had a five-story steam-powered cotton factory that was located on Greene Street that produced cotton and sheeting and was the first of its type in North Carolina.

Humphries had 75 looms in production by 1833 and his goods were sold in north Georgia, South Carolina, Tennessee, and Virginia.
